Fat But Fit is Still Bad for the Heart

Fat But Fit is Still Bad for the Heart

User: null Staff Reports

Spanish researchers have found physical activity is not enough to undo the negative effects of excess body weight on the heart.

Less Exercise Could Mean More Depression

Less Exercise Could Mean More Depression

User: null Staff Reports

Researchers at University College London found people with low aerobic and muscular fitness are almost twice as likely to experience depression.

Mouthwash Blocks the Benefits of Exercise

Mouthwash Blocks the Benefits of Exercise

User: null Staff Reports

Researchers at the University of Plymouth (England) have discovered using antibacterial mouthwash after working out cuts the blood pressure reduction of exercise by as much as 60 percent.
